Acquisition puts Stockport firm on path to next stage of growth journey

Christian Mancier

Gorvins Solicitors has advised Stockport-based nationwide printer and photocopier supplier, Leemic, on its acquisition by DMC Canotec, of Croydon, a provider of managed print services and document management systems, for an undisclosed sum.

Leemic serves a significant number of customers across the North.

Now, as part of DMC Group it will help strengthen DMC’s reach across the region adding to its existing operations in Gateshead, Manchester and York.

The acquisition also provides DMC with the opportunity to expand into Scotland where Leemic has a growing sales and service operation.

This acquisition adds a further £3.5m of revenue to the Horizon Capital-backed DMC Group, taking total revenues close to £70m.

Gorvins has supported Leemic with legal advice for the past 15 years on a range of matters from the original purchase of the Leemic business through to share option schemes for key employees and the actual sale to DMC group.
